Wild animals need stronger protections
Billions of wild animals are traded every year for commercial, medicinal, and hunting trophy purposes, and demand for the rarest and most threatened species is growing despite dwindling numbers of these precious creatures. The 17th meeting of the Conference of the Parties to the Convention on International Trade in Endangered Species of Wild Fauna and Flora (CITES) is quickly approaching—a forum at which nearly every country in the world comes together to decide how much protection from trade is offered to endangered and threatened species.

This year, protections for sharks, pangolins, and lions could be increased, but we need your strong voice to help these precious animals.
